Effect of polyphenol extracts on glutathione peroxidase enzyme activity in conditions of toxic hepatitis

Abstract

In this study, the inhibitory effects of helmar-1 and helmar-2 polyphenol extracts isolated from the helichrysummaracandicum plant on the activity of the antioxidant glutathione peroxides enzymes in a toxic hepatitis model were compared with silymarin.To induce toxic hepatitis, the subcutaneous area of the abdomens of the experimental animals were injected twice a week with a 50% solution of carbon tetrachloride in olive oil at a dose of 1 ml/kg. After an increase in the levels of the enzymes alanine aminotransferase (ALT) and aspartate aminotransferase (AST) were observed in the bloodplasma,which indicates toxic hepatitis, the helmar-1 and helmar-2 polyphenol extracts and silymarin were administered subcutaneously at a dose of 20 mg/kg once daily for 15 days for pharmacocorrection.
